- website server lookup history
- 835ff5.768pv.top
- www.peppapigdz.com
- jxryhj.com
- qujiang.androidapkdownload.com
- ky5681246.cc
- kssjxkt.com
- shitai.androidapkdownload.com
- 6547ee.com
- www.191ms.com
- 13984.com
- zxsyy.net
- m5v.cc389.com
- 365c7.cc
- www.fuqisy.com
- www.peppapigpr.com
- 2807.weikun365.com
- fut.clksde.com
- 66189.com
- www.dyyy.net
- www.cableav.cc
- hosting ip address lookup history
- 39.104.95.114
- 142.91.92.79
- 118.123.249.249
- 107.148.194.206
- 38.11.144.237
- 23.194.242.130
- 154.82.100.220
- 13.225.117.143
- 38.143.11.248
- 38.12.125.187
- 45.201.225.53
- 38.238.220.227
- 156.247.48.238
- 139.129.234.221
- 103.215.81.82
- 101.132.142.154
- 122.144.152.131
- 104.17.239.79
- 23.104.247.204
- 156.234.134.156
